I didn't like the name change, but I think people are too busy taking the piss to probably understand why they did it in the first place. Is HBO a prestigious brand? Absolutely, I think most of us can agree that it is.

It's also a brand with a pretty well established ceiling and the service aimed to be something bigger than just HBO. It was basically a complete extension of all things WB and Discovery and in a game where you need as many subscribers as you can get 100+ million, you have to try and remove that ceiling associated with HBO. Prestige TV isn't for everyone and network tv routinely gets better ratings, it's cheap and easy to consume.

I think they got the most out of the Max branding and they decided changing back to HBO has merit too. No one is going to cancel their service now because they already know what the service is, but now you can have that prestige back and maybe get back some subscribers who don't know that this is HBO.

They've had tremendous success with House of the Dragon, TLOU, White Lotus, and Succession. The timing is right to rebrand.
